      The Zionist movement started as a secular one, and a plurality in Israel are still secular. The Palestine Liberation Organization (PLO) started as a secular Marxist organization. Religion has only entered the conflict after the collapse of the Soviet Union, with the support of the Netanyahu wing of Likud for both Hamas and Jewish extremists. Many atrocities, including the Nakba and the Israeli invasion of Lebanon, happened under completely secular rule. Religion is not central or essential to the conflict, history is, identity is, and secular Jewish ethnic supremacism is. Stop projecting your militant atheist wishful thinking onto this conflict.
